I wanted to know what you guys think about this alternative the Nets could be thinking about, according to Fred Kerber:
But King echoed the need for a starting power forward, one who can produce until rookie Derrick Favors ascends to the throne. One line of thinking says the Nets should start Favors early with a veteran (a Kurt Thomas type) behind him. Then, if there is success, they could look at players in the last year of deals (Troy Murphy, Kenyon Martin if healthy) to finish the season. But even with more than $14 million remaining in cap space, King does not want to rush it.
